Face Shape and Balance
Your face shape is one of the biggest clues in finding a haircut that flatters you. Certain cuts naturally enhance particular shapes — for example, long layers can soften a square jaw, while a sleek bob brings out strong cheekbones.
Here’s a quick guide to what generally works well:
- Round faces: Longer, layered styles that create length.
- Square faces: Soft waves or textured ends to balance strong angles.
- Oval faces: Lucky you — most cuts work beautifully!
- Heart-shaped faces: Side parts and gentle layers to balance a narrow chin.

Texture and Lifestyle
Even the most stunning cut won’t work if it doesn’t suit your hair texture or daily routine. A blunt bob might look amazing in photos but feel frustrating if you’ve got fine, frizzy, or curly hair that needs extra time to style.
A good haircut fits into your life, not the other way around. If you don’t have much time in the mornings, your stylist should create something that air-dries beautifully or takes minimal effort to maintain.

Stylist Feedback and Upkeep
Your stylist is your mirror before the mirror. They’ll know if a haircut suits you long before the blow-dryer’s turned off. A good stylist watches how your hair moves, falls, and frames your face — adjusting as they go to make the end result feel balanced and natural.
After your appointment, they’ll also give you advice on how to keep your style looking its best, from product recommendations to simple styling tips. If your hair still looks great weeks later and feels easy to manage, that’s another clear sign the cut works for you.
